Close Brothers Group plc, a long-established merchant bank, offers a comprehensive range of financial services to private individuals and growing small businesses throughout the United Kingdom. Its operations are strategically structured across five key divisions: Commercial, Retail, Property, Asset Management, and Securities. The firm provides various savings opportunities, including personal and corporate accounts, as well as pension deposits. Beyond this, it extends a broad spectrum of lending and finance solutions, such as asset finance, asset-backed lending, commercial vehicle acquisition funding, short-term bridging loans, insurance premium financing, invoice factoring, and bespoke property finance. Close Brothers also caters to niche sectors, offering specialized funding for general aviation aircraft, diverse leisure and commercial marine vessels, and brewery ventures. Furthermore, it supports essential industries like agriculture, construction, manufacturing, and transport with tailored financial arrangements. Leasing services are available for equipment in construction, manufacturing, IT, and other specialist assets. The company also addresses the specific financial requirements of the professional services sector, providing loan, hire purchase, leasing, and refinancing options for dental, medical, pharmacy, and veterinary practices. In the realm of wealth management, Close Brothers delivers financial education, investment management, and comprehensive financial planning and advisory services. It empowers self-directed investors with online portfolio management tools and offers dedicated support for financial advisers. For capital markets, the group furnishes liquidity and agile execution services to retail stockbrokers, wealth managers, and institutional investors. This encompasses market making, sales, research, and corporate broking expertise, alongside managing dealing, custody, and settlement functions for its institutional, wealth management, and brokerage clientele. Close Brothers Group plc, originally established in 1878, maintains its headquarters in London, United Kingdom.
